Transaction 39d596e9b860a5a34fcfbb2c7550ec1292356ce173e685eae02ac8da27d5be69

block
18dd8454dd592fe3ffef0cabe96a2928f93f620ad27affed8ae5046e6a075494

1 Input

24 Outputs